The Ministry of Religious Affairs presented various potential collaboration programmes, including a programme to send imams from Brunei Darussalam to mosques in Australia at appropriate times. It is an effort to strengthen bilateral relations as well as expand the sharing of experiences and expertise in the development of Islamic teachings between the two countries. The matter was discussed during a courtesy call from the President of the Australian National Imams Council (ANIC) to the Minister of Religious Affairs. The courtesy call took place at the Ministry of Religious Affairs, Jalan Dewan Majlis, 12th May morning.
Yang Berhormat Pehin Udana Khatib Dato Paduka Seri Setia Ustaz Awang Haji Badaruddin bin Pengarah Dato Paduka Awang Haji Othman received a courtesy call from Imam Shadi Alsuleiman who is on a two-day official visit to the country. Also present was His Excellency Michael Hoy, Australian High Commissioner to Brunei Darussalam.
The courtesy call acts as a platform to exchange views and experiences, as well as discuss opportunities for cooperation in the field of religious services. Imam Shadi Alsuleiman's visit to the country is sponsored by the Australian Government. The visit is also a follow-up to the visit of Dr Susan Carland, Australian Sociologist of Religion to Brunei Darussalam in 2025.
